  Finding areas where one contractor installed their systems without regards to other areas is fairly common for all of us. Looking for these areas is part of our job. Most of the time it's a minor issue like a notched drawer to make room for a plumbing trap. Sometimes it can be a big no no like a notched joist to make room for an air return or cut trusses to make room for the whole house fan.

Basement BathroomRecently during a Canton Michigan Home Inspection  I noticed the builder was nice enough to make provisions in the basement for a bathroom, as is common in new construction, should the owners decide to finish the basement. Drains were there extending above the floor as they should be. But for reasons unknown they were inches from the stairwell and a foot or so from the water heater and furnace. My guess is someone didn't review the blueprints?? The homeowner can probably get away with the bathroom installation but it will be a tight squeeze. I don't think there's even enough room for a 2x4 between the shower drain and the stairwell.
